Anyway, he told me that it isn't getting spark, and he didn't want to mess with it.
I suspect that it is the CDI or the Stator, but wanted to see what you guys thought.
The brown wire coming from the CDI, I have 9v, which is what it should have if I am correct. I am not sure if that means the CDI is working or not.
I ohm tested the coil and it ohm tested good.
Moving on to the stator testing, I ran out of time during my lunch today and didn't get a chance to tinker with it this evening. I had tested some of it, but I had not got to finish everything.
Black to ground was 0 ohms
blk to purple was 7.5 ohms if I recall correctly, which manual states it should be 5.5, not sure if this is an issue or not, manual doesn't state any +/- tolerances.
Hall sensors red and green wire with a 9v battery both show 106 ohms which manual states should be 25 ohms or less.
I also seen some issues regarding other things like the start/stop switch on these, but my trim works and it tries to start...not saying the switch is good but I seen some people say it wouldn't stay running without holding the button, or only when they turned the pump on and I tried that with no change.
